Chameleon bubbles are formed when a sodium alginate solution is dropped into a calcium chloride solution.  The bubbles are filled by an acid‐base indicator solution; so, adding the beads to acids or bases leads to colour changes inside the bubbles by diffusion and pH change. Two translucent liquids are mixed. At first, nothing happens: the resulting solution is still translucent. Suddenly, with no warning, the solution turns blue-black all at once.

Curriculum links include redox reactions, rate of reaction, kinetics

In this project, students make their own aspirin or paracetamol and then test the purity of the pain-reliever and compare it to shop-bought.  This covers titrations, chromatography and other analytical techniques.

In this independent research project students research the causes and consequences of diarrhoea and dehydration. They find out about the different treatments available for dehydration and design some experiments to compare commercial and homemade oral rehydration salts.
